The Board of BUA Foods Plc, is pleased to announce the appointment of Mr. Isyaku Abdulsamad “Khalifa” Rabiu as Chief Officer, Global Procurement and Strategic Operations.
Khalifa is an accomplished leader with a strong record of driving strategic initiatives that enhance operational efficiency, reinforce supply chain resilience, optimise costs, mitigate risk, and support sustainable organisational growth. His professional experience spans the food, cement, and animal feed industries.
He played a pivotal role as Director, Special Operations (DSO), BUA Group, impacting strategic raw-material procurement, particularly in wheat sourcing, significantly improving supply continuity. He also led the establishment of a 40 metric tonne-per-hour animal feed mill and was central to the commercial re-entry of BUA Rice Mills, culminating in the successful reintroduction of BUA rice products into the Nigerian market.
Khalifa holds a Bachelor’s degree in International Relations from Regent’s University London and a Master’s in Management (MiM) from Georgetown University’s McDonough School of Business.
Please join us in congratulating Mr. Isyaku Abdulsamad “Khalifa” Rabiu on this appointment.

PDP Is Alive and Strong — Former President Jonathan
Former President Dr. Goodluck Ebele Jonathan, GCFR, @GEJonathan has expressed satisfaction that the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) @OfficialPDPNig remains alive, strong, and resilient, contrary to speculations in some sections of the media.
Dr. Jonathan reaffirmed that the PDP remains a fundamental pillar of Nigeria’s democracy, noting that it is the only surviving original political party since 1998.
The former President made this remark while receiving members of the National Working Committee (NWC) of the party, led by the National Chairman, Dr. Kabiru Tanimu Turaki, SAN, during a high-level consultative meeting held at his private office in Abuja on Tuesday evening, January 6, 2026.
The meeting focused on the party’s reconciliation process and strategic repositioning ahead of the 2027 general elections.
Dr. Jonathan noted that the PDP possesses the historical resilience and institutional strength required to overcome its current internal challenges, describing the party as more than a political platform but a national institution.
“The PDP, being the only surviving original political party since 1998, has been a critical contributor to our democracy since 1999. I have been a beneficiary of this party, which gave me the opportunity to serve as Deputy Governor, Governor, Vice President, and President. I am grateful to the party and will continue to contribute my quota because I feel deeply indebted to it,” he said.
He urged the party’s leadership to place national interest and institutional development above personal considerations, stressing that strong political parties are essential for democratic stability.
Earlier in his remarks, Dr. Turaki thanked the former President for his fatherly counsel and unwavering loyalty to the PDP. He assured him that the current leadership is committed to a comprehensive “Rebirth Agenda” aimed at rebuilding and strengthening the party.
“We came to seek your guidance and to brief you on the prospects and challenges before the party. Our goal is to return power to the people and reposition the PDP as the party of the majority of Nigerians. We are reaching out to aggrieved members because a united PDP remains the most viable platform for a balanced and prosperous Nigeria,” Dr. Turaki stated.
Members of the delegation included H.E. Dr. Mu’azu Babangida Aliyu, Prof. Jerry Gana, Gen. Ishaya Bamaiyi, Hajiya Zainab Maina, Chief Mike Oghiadome, Mohammed Bello Adoke, SAN, and other members of the National Working Committee.
